6. • Los condicionales permiten al programa escoger
entre varios posibles resultados dependiendo de la
evaluación de una condición.
• Un condicional solo puede retornar el valor de
verdadero o falso.
• Un condicional siempre retorna un resultado
7. • Modo de ejecución:
if (condición) operación1;
else operación2;
Si la condición es cierta, se ejecutara la
“operacion1” y finalizara el condicional.
Sino (else) es cierta la condición, se ejecutara la
“operacion2” y finalizara el condicional
9. Las variables son estructura de datos usados para
almacenar información. Hay dos tipos de información
que puede ser almacenada:
Números y texto. Antes de usar una variable ésta,
deberá primero ser definida:
Dim nombre_de_variable As Tipo
Dim precio As Long
Dim nombre_de_articulo As String
10. CONDICIONALESY ESTRUCTURAS DE
CONTROL
Las estructuras de control le permiten controlar el flujo de
ejecución del programa. Tenemos dos tipos de estructuras de
control:
11. ESTRUCTURAS DE DECISION
Condición normalmente es una comparación, pero
puede ser cualquier expresión que dé como resultado un
valor numérico. Visual Basic interpreta este valor como
True o False; un valor numérico cero es False y se
considera True cualquier valor numérico distinto de cero.
Si condición es True, Visual Basic ejecuta todas las
sentencias que siguen a la palabra clave Then. Puede
utilizar sintaxis de una línea o de varias líneas para
ejecutar una sentencia basada en una condición, los
siguientes dos ejemplos son equivalentes:
12. If condición1 Then
[bloque de sentencias 1]
[ElseIf condición2 Then
[bloque de sentencias 2]] ...
[Else
[bloque de sentencias n]]
End If
13. ESTRUCTURA DE BUCLE
Las estructuras de repetición o bucle le
permiten ejecutar una o más líneas de código
repetidamente. Las estructuras de repetición
que acepta Visual Basic son:
Do...Loop
For...Next
For Each...Next